The time is upon us once again, and because this time is short, we need to make memorable moments. Here are five tips on how you can make the most of your vacation.

 

 

Tip #1 Leave Worries at Home

Relax. No one enjoys a school break if stress is their shadow. If you know something from your everyday life will dampen your good time, take care of it before leaving. Tip #2 Make a Spring Break Bucket List

Bucket lists should be full of fun and adventure. You want to write things that excite you, intimidate you, and pursue exploration.  Bucket lists are meant to be the start of a wild dream coming true, so be bold and creative.

 

Tip #3 Say ”Yes” More

We all love the idea of new experiences, but when presented with something new, our default is to decline.  Instead, challenge yourself to embrace the opposite.  Wake up early to do something unfamiliar, and dare to do something daunting-wear a bikini without a cover, or do karaoke sober.

 

Tip #4 Enjoy the moment

We live in an age of oversharing, and this is distracting. I advise you to only document special moments. If it is worth remembering on your own, taking a video will add more value to your time.

 

Tip #5 Plan for your location

Before going anywhere, make a budget for the entire trip. Activities, arrival, departure, and food should be covered, but do not forget about shopping and other spontaneous purchases. Now, I do not recommend making a full itinerary for a vacation, but some events have a specified time and place,  so do your research, and book whatever you want before arriving.
